Ghash是一种加密哈希函数,它属于哈希算法的一种,哈希算法是一种将任意长度的输入转化为固定长度输出的算法,这种转化是通过一定的计算规则和公式完成的,在这个过程中,输入的数据经过哈希算法处理后,会生成一个独特的哈希值,这个哈希值具有唯一性,即使输入的数据发生微小的变化,输出的哈希值也会发生巨大的变化,哈希算法广泛应用于数据的校验、加密和数字签名等领域。

Ghash作为哈希算法的一种,具有高效性和安全性,它可以将任意长度的数据通过特定的计算步骤转化为固定长度的哈希值,在这个过程中,Ghash算法采用了特定的加密算法和安全参数,保证了其生成的哈希值的唯一性和安全性,由于其高效性和安全性,Ghash被广泛应用于数据加密、网络安全和数据存储等领域。
在数据加密领域,Ghash可以用于数据的完整性校验和数据的加密存储,通过对数据进行哈希计算,可以生成一个唯一的哈希值,用于验证数据的完整性和未被篡改,由于哈希算法的特性,即使不知道加密算法的具体步骤,也可以通过哈希值来验证数据的正确性,在网络安全领域,Ghash可以用于生成数字签名和验证身份,通过对数据进行哈希计算并加密处理,可以生成一个唯一的数字签名,用于验证数据的来源和完整性,在数据存储领域,Ghash也可以用于生成数据索引和存储位置信息,提高数据存储和检索的效率。
相关问答
问:什么是哈希算法?
答:哈希算法是一种将任意长度的输入转化为固定长度输出的算法,它通过将输入数据进行特定的计算处理和转化规则,生成一个唯一的哈希值,哈希算法广泛应用于数据的校验、加密和数字签名等领域。
问:Ghash与其他的哈希算法有什么不同?
答:Ghash作为一种哈希算法,具有高效性和安全性,它采用了特定的加密算法和安全参数,保证了生成的哈希值的唯一性和安全性,与其他哈希算法相比,Ghash在某些特定领域具有更好的性能和安全性,不同的哈希算法可能采用不同的计算步骤和参数设置,以适应不同的应用场景需求,在选择使用哈希算法时需要根据具体的应用场景和需求进行选择。
问:如何使用Ghash进行数据加密?
答:使用Ghash进行数据加密可以通过以下步骤实现:对原始数据进行哈希计算并生成一个唯一的哈希值;对哈希值进行加密处理并生成一个加密后的数字签名;将数字签名用于验证数据的完整性和来源,通过这种方式可以实现数据的加密存储和传输安全。


还没有评论,来说两句吧...